Just how low can I go and still be able to play at least one game at a time.
4 GB would be sufficient?

If your intention is to only play one game at a time then 4GB is all you need. In fact, 4GB is enough for quite a few games depending on the title obviously. You'll get 2-3 full retail games on their easily and maybe a couple of smaller indie titles as well.

Depends on the game & if you're talking digital only or game cart. Some higher end digital games like Code:Realize, Disgaea 4, Final Fantasy X, MGS HD Collection, etc are 3gb-3.5gb in size. When you figure formatting loss, misc loss due to OS, & save game sizes, I don't think 4gb will quite cut it.
(This is all assuming legit system w/ legit games, "backups" on a CFW I can't comment on)
